    Specificité
    This Monoclonal antibody clone X-2 recognizes a 110 kDa O-sialoglycoprotein on granulocytes, monocytes and endothelial cells. Upon differentiation of cultivated monocytes into macrophages, CDw93 ceases to be expressed on day 5-6, which makes it a very useful marker to differentiate those two cell populations. Antigen Distribution Isolated Cells: Positive with all granulocytes, with staining increasing transiently upon maturation. Antigen expression is increased by TNFα, GM-CSF, (fMLP) treatment. No effect on superoxide production by binding to neutrophils has been noted. PMA stimulation causes down regulation of the antigen. Positive with monocytes following fMLP, TNF, GM-CSF treatment. Antigen expression decreases on cultured monocytes. Positive on AML cases with monocytic component. Positive on cell lines HL-60, Namalva, K562, THP-1, U937, negative on HMC-1 (human mast cell line). Tissue Sections: The Monoclonal antibody X-2 stains epitheloid cells and Rosai-Dorfman cells and most endothelial cells in the synovial membrane of RA patients.

    Sujet
    CD93 a cell-surface glycoprotein and type I membrane protein involve in intercellular adhesion and in the clearance of apoptotic cells. The intracellular cytoplasmic tail of this protein has been found to interact with moesin, a protein known to play a role in linking transmembrane proteins to the cytoskeleton and in the remodelling of the cytoskeleton.Synonyms: C1q receptor, C1q/MBL/SPA receptor, CDw93, Complement component 1 q subcomponent receptor 1, Complement component C1q receptor, MBL receptor, MXRA4, Matrix-remodeling-associated protein 4, SPA receptor
